High speeds, extreme loads, powerful accelerations and sharp emergency braking – only forged railway wheels can meet these requirements. Railway wheels are forged in four working steps before they undergo mechanical machining. First of all, a disk-shaped preform is produced in two stages from a heated block. This preform is then rolled out into the final contour using a wheel roller. Finally, the rolled-out wheel is calibrated and the hub is offset axially and pierced.

A forged and rolled high-speed wheel is a type of train wheel used in high-speed rail systems, manufactured through forging and rolling processes. In the manufacturing process, the wheel undergoes forging initially, where high temperature and pressure are applied to induce plastic deformation in the metal material, shaping it into the desired form and structure. Subsequently, it goes through rolling processes to further refine and shape it to precise dimensions and surface quality standards. Forged and rolled high-speed wheels typically possess more uniform internal structure, higher strength, and fatigue resistance, making them suitable for high-speed railway systems, ensuring safer and more stable train operations.
